## Learning across borders and backgrounds

MTF Institute serves an international professional community. Learners arrive with different languages, cultures, careers, ages, beliefs, abilities and levels of prior education. That variety improves discussion when people can participate without being stereotyped, dismissed or pressured to hide relevant parts of their identity.

## Our working principles

- Respect the dignity and agency of each learner.
- Assess work against communicated learning criteria.
- Use examples that make sense across regions rather than assuming one national context is universal.
- Avoid unnecessary barriers in language, format and digital interaction.
- Respond to credible concerns about harassment, discrimination or exclusion.
- Improve materials when learners identify a genuine accessibility or cultural problem.

## Inclusion does not remove standards

An inclusive environment still requires academic honesty, professional conduct and evidence-based discussion. Different perspectives may be challenged, but the challenge should be relevant, proportionate and directed at the claim rather than the person. Inclusion also does not guarantee that every program or platform feature will meet every individual requirement; learners should contact us before enrollment when a specific accommodation is essential.

## MTF Policy of Inclusion and Diversity

**Introduction**

1.1 IMTF is committed to fostering a diverse and inclusive learning and working environment that values and respects individuals from all backgrounds, irrespective of their race, ethnicity, gender, sexual orientation, religion, age, disability, or socio-economic status.

1.2 This policy aims to promote inclusivity, celebrate diversity, and ensure equal opportunities for all members of the IMTF community, including students, faculty, staff, and visitors.

**Non-Discrimination**

2.1 IMTF strictly prohibits discrimination, harassment, or any form of prejudice based on race, ethnicity, gender, sexual orientation, religion, age, disability, or socio-economic status.

2.2 All members of the IMTF community are expected to treat each other with respect, fairness, and dignity, fostering an environment free from bias and discrimination.

2.3 Any incidents of discrimination or harassment should be promptly reported and will be appropriately addressed by IMTF.

**Recruitment and Admissions**

3.1 IMTF is committed to recruiting a diverse and talented student body, ensuring equal opportunities for applicants from all backgrounds.

3.2 Admissions decisions will be based on merit, academic qualifications, and potential, without any discrimination or bias.

**Curriculum and Pedagogy**

4.1 IMTF will strive to provide a curriculum that reflects diverse perspectives and experiences, fostering a comprehensive understanding of different cultures, societies, and global perspectives.

4.2 Faculty members will incorporate inclusive teaching methodologies and resources, ensuring that all students feel represented and engaged in the learning process.

4.3 IMTF will promote interdisciplinary approaches, encouraging the exploration of various disciplines and fostering a holistic understanding of complex issues.

**Campus Climate and Support**

5.1 IMTF will create a campus climate that is inclusive, welcoming, and supportive of all individuals, regardless of their background.

5.2 Support services, resources, and facilities will be available to assist students from diverse backgrounds, including those with disabilities, to ensure equal access to education and participation.

5.3 IMTF will provide training and workshops to faculty, staff, and students on cultural competence, unconscious bias, and promoting inclusivity.

**Awareness and Celebrations**

6.1 IMTF will organize events, seminars, workshops, and cultural celebrations that promote awareness, understanding, and appreciation of diverse cultures, traditions, and identities.

6.2 IMTF will encourage student clubs and organizations to create platforms for dialogue, collaboration, and engagement on issues related to diversity and inclusion.

6.3 IMTF will actively engage with external organizations, networks, and communities to foster partnerships and promote diversity initiatives.

**Evaluation and Accountability**

7.1 IMTF will periodically assess the effectiveness of diversity and inclusion initiatives, monitoring progress and identifying areas for improvement.

7.2 The institution will hold individuals accountable for any behavior or actions that contradict the principles of inclusion and diversity, ensuring appropriate consequences and remedial measures are implemented.

**Communication and Transparency**

8.1 IMTF will communicate its commitment to inclusion and diversity through various channels, including the institution&#039;s website, official documents, and internal communications.

8.2 Updates, progress, and achievements in promoting inclusion and diversity will be shared with the IMTF community to foster transparency and engagement.

**Review and Revision**

9.1 This policy will be periodically reviewed to ensure its alignment with the evolving needs and aspirations of the IMTF community.

9.2 Input and feedback from stakeholders will be considered during the review process to enhance the effectiveness and impact of the policy.
